Our Services
Our comprehensive suite of neurology services includes:
- Spine surgery
- Neurointervention and neurosurgery for conditions that affect the circulation of blood to the brain including aneurysms, atherosclerosis, spinal compression fractures and more.
- Treatment of brain tumors
- Neuro Critical Care Unit
- Dedicated inpatient stroke unit
- Continuous ICU EEG monitoring
- Transcranial Doppler (TCD)
- Intraoperative Neurophysiologic Monitoring (NIOM)
- Acute Inpatient Rehabilitation Program
In collaboration with our community physicians, we offer programs and services for:
- Chronic headache
- Outpatient Rehabilitation Program – physical, occupational and speech therapy services
